What are the main financial stats of VST

Earnings

Shares outstanding

482.06M

Market cap

$7.9B

Enterprise value

$19.16B

Price to earnings (P/E)

N/A

Price to book (P/B)

1.3

Price to sales (P/S)

0.67

EV/EBIT

N/A

EV/EBITDA

26.17

EV/Sales

1.62

Revenue

$11.79B

EBIT

-$1.34B

EBITDA

$732M

Free cash flow

-$34M

Liquidity

EPS

-$3.02

Free cash flow per share

-$0.07

Book value per share

$12.61

Revenue per share

$24.33

TBVPS

$43.27

Total assets

$25.89B

Total liabilities

$19.79B

Debt

$11.86B

Equity

$6.1B

Working capital

-$1.72B

Debt to equity

1.94

Current ratio

0.68

Quick ratio

0.35

Net debt/EBITDA

15.39

Dividend

EBITDA margin

6.2%

Gross margin

27.2%

Net margin

-12.4%

Operating margin

-12.3%

Return on assets

-5.7%

Return on equity

-18.9%

Return on invested capital

-5%

Return on capital employed

-6.5%

Return on sales

-11.3%

Dividend yield

3.39%

DPS

$0.56

Payout ratio

N/A

How has the Vistra stock price performed over time

Intraday

1.99%

1 week

2.06%

1 month

-7.09%

1 year

-12.45%

YTD

-16.68%

QTD

-7.35%

How have Vistra's revenue and profit performed over time

Revenue

$11.79B

Gross profit

$3.21B

Operating income

-$1.45B

Net income

-$1.46B

Gross margin

27.2%

Net margin

-12.4%

Vistra's operating income has plunged by 196% from the previous quarter and by 177% YoY

VST's operating margin has plunged by 192% from the previous quarter and by 176% YoY

What is Vistra's growth rate over time

What is Vistra stock price valuation

P/E

N/A

P/B

1.3

P/S

0.67

EV/EBIT

N/A

EV/EBITDA

26.17

EV/Sales

1.62

The equity has contracted by 27% from the previous quarter and by 23% YoY

The P/B is 6% above the last 4 quarters average of 1.2 but 2.3% below the 5-year quarterly average of 1.3

VST's P/S is 45% below its 5-year quarterly average of 1.2 and 18% below its last 4 quarters average of 0.8

Vistra's revenue has increased by 3% from the previous quarter

How efficient is Vistra business performance

VST's return on invested capital has dropped by 188% since the previous quarter and by 176% year-on-year

Vistra's ROS has plunged by 184% from the previous quarter and by 171% YoY

What is VST's dividend history

DPS

$0.56

Dividend yield

3.39%

Payout ratio

N/A

Recent dividends

How did Vistra financials performed over time

VST's total assets is 31% higher than its total liabilities

VST's current ratio is down by 40% since the previous quarter and by 31% year-on-year

The quick ratio has contracted by 39% from the previous quarter and by 15% YoY

The debt is 94% greater than the equity

Vistra's debt to equity has surged by 67% QoQ and by 36% YoY

The equity has contracted by 27% from the previous quarter and by 23% YoY

All financial data is based on trailing twelve months (TTM) periods - updated quarterly, unless otherwise specified.